Program Overview


The Forest Management concentration in Forest and Rangeland Stewardship offers a comprehensive forestry education with a focus on practical forestland management. The four-year program covers biological, physical, social, and management sciences, preparing students for careers in forest ecology and principles. The program requires 120 credits, including at least 42 upper-division courses, and includes a summer field measurements course.
